Nadaillac is situated on the borders of the Périgord, between the Quercy Causses and the Corrézian country. The word comes from a Gallo-Roman personal name followed by "acum": Natalius formed from the Latin Natalis (natal, by birth) and means "the domain of Christmas" !
The parish of Nadaillac is mentioned as early as 1099 in the cartulary of Uzerche. It was in the 18th century that Nadaillac-le-sec was specified: no watercourse crosses it and there is only one fountain, the Fountain of Beauty.
Nadaillac is a small rural village where life is good. One of its particularities: engravings on almost all the houses of the village! Its heritage is not lacking in charm!
